Can anyone verify some of the wiring diagram for the 2008 Toyota Sequoia.  I am trying to locate the wires for the factory alarm buzzer and parking light flashing.  When you lock or unlock using the factory remote, it sounds a remote buzzer and flashes the parking lights to confirm that it has locked or unlocked.  I recently installed a remote start and would like to tie the lock/unlock function to the factory buzzer and parking lights so that they operate the same when using the aftermarket remote lock/unlock.  I have looked at the wiring diagram listing here, and attempted to find/verify the correct wires... but still having a little trouble.  Thanks.

lights (+) 18 ga. green at P.D.B. top left vertical connector
lights (+) 20 ga. Orange at bottom of light switch in steering column
